Here are they. 

Ø  Stand behind your better half, hand around her neck, and put your lips around her ears.

Ø  Go to a tree, stand taking the support of the tree, keep her hand on your chest, hold her hand gently, and take your nose in the contact of her.

Ø  Go to a beautiful place, make her sit on your lap, keep hands on upper thighs or hips, unbutton your shirt, ask her to hold your shirt in a wild style, and take your nose in contact with hers.

Ø  Hang her on your back, give her support by your hands, and ask her to look into your eyes.

Ø  Stand near the water joining each other, and ask the photographer to take reflection photos.


These are just some of the best photoshoot ideas. Before your photoshoot, do discuss about these photoshoot ideas with your professional photographer, and he will allow you to have a great photo session.
